Got this from an investor on G*IG board. Thought I'd share:

Slapping the ask doesn't help unless the bid is sitting right up against the ask (example .002x.0021).
Slapping the ask when there's no bid support (.002x.0025) is of no value and leaves the person who is slapping the ask holding stocks with unnecessarily inflated share price while the mms walk the ask down.
Also, by leaving a gap between the bid and ask, it makes it less attractive to new investors.

How to walk the bid up:

1. enter a small buy order at the bid.
2. slowly move the buy pps up until it is one tick away from ask.
